Which Framerate? ... Which settings did You use in RB?
CCE Settings:
NTSC 23.976 prog
UFF,PFF,GOP12,23.976FPS,ZZ,PULLDOWN,TC0x100000
NTSC 23.976 interlaced
UFF,GOP12,23,97FPS,ALT,PULLDOWN,TC0x100000
NTSC 29.976 prog
PFF,GOP15,29,97FPS,ZZ,TC0x000000
NTSC 29.976 interlaced
PFF,GOP15,29.976FPS,ALT,TC0x000000
